  • Ever wondered how often Rome crosses your mind in a day? Grab your time-travel gear and join us, Tanner and Darren, as we journey back to the grandeur of the Roman Empire. Our conversation takes off from the Republic's inception in 509 BC, sailing through its transformation into an Empire under Augustus Caesar in 27 BC, and peaking at its zenith under Emperor Trajan. We'll also give you a snapshot of the Empire's population during the time of Jesus and a comparison with the world population growth over the past 50 years. 

    It's time to unravel the enduring legacy of the Romans - their tongue is woven into our language, their legal systems form the bedrock of ours, and their representative government has set the stage for modern democracies. As architects and engineers, they've left us in awe with their enduring structures, from roads to aqueducts. We'll also explore how they adopted and adapted Greek culture and religion, a cultural exchange that has shaped the world in profound ways. Finally, let's talk about the Roman Empire's influence on your daily life. Get ready to share your favorite Roman fact and reflect on how often you think about Rome in your daily life.
